量子计算在信息安全领域的前景探析
量子计算是当前科技发展的前沿领域之一,它依托于量子力学原理,具有独特的计算能力和应用前景。在信息安全领域,量子计算技术也可能带来革命性的变革,为密码学和网络安全带来全新的挑战与机遇。
一、量子计算对传统密码学的挑战
目前广泛使用的公钥密码体系,如RSA和椭圆曲线密码(ECC),其安全性主要依赖于大整数分解和离散对数问题的难解性。然而,量子计算机拥有的强大计算能力,可能会大幅缩短这些问题的求解时间,从而对现有密码算法构成致命打击。例如,Peter Shor提出的量子算法可以在多项式时间内完成大整数因式分解,这将使RSA等密码体系失去安全基础。因此,面对量子计算的威胁,传统密码学需要寻求全新的解决方案。
二、量子密码学的兴起
为应对量子计算的安全挑战,量子密码学应运而生。量子密码学利用量子力学的基本原理,如量子纠缠、量子隧穿等,构建崭新的密码体系。其中,量子密钥分发(QKD)技术是最成熟的量子密码学应用之一。QKD利用单个量子粒子的无复制性和量子测量的不可逆性,实现了两方之间的安全密钥分发,保证了通信的绝对安全性。与传统密码学相比,量子密码学提供了一种全新的、基于物理原理的信息安全保护方式,可以有效抵御量子计算机的威胁。
三、量子计算机与量子密码学的博弈
随着量子计算技术的不断发展,量子计算机和量子密码学之间的博弈也愈演愈烈。一方面,量子计算机的进步可能推动量子密码学的快速发展,迫使其不断提高安全性和抗量子攻击能力;另一方面,量子密码学的发展也可能倒逼量子计算机技术的进步,以应对更加强大的量子密码体系。
此外,量子计算机与量子密码学的相互影响还体现在量子安全算法的研发上。随着量子计算能力的提升,传统加密算法的安全性必将受到严峻考验,这也促进了量子安全算法的蓬勃发展。例如,后量子密码算法(PQC)就是一类抗量子攻击的新型密码算法,旨在替代现有易受量子计算机攻击的公钥密码体系。
四、量子计算在信息安全领域的应用前景
尽管当前量子计算技术还不够成熟,但其在信息安全领域的应用前景广阔。除了上述提到的量子密码学,量子计算还可能在其他信息安全领域发挥重要作用:
1. 量子参数优化:量子计算可用于优化复杂的密码系统参数,提高系统的抗攻击能力。
2. 量子随机数生成:利用量子力学原理生成真随机数,可为密钥生成提供更安全的随机源。
3. 量子模拟与量子机器学习:量子模拟可用于分析网络安全威胁,量子机器学习可用于检测网络异常行为。
总之,量子计算技术的发展必将深刻影响信息安全领域,给传统密码学和网络安全带来巨大冲击。应对这一挑战,需要学习和掌握量子密码学、量子通信等新兴技术,与时俱进地构建全新的信息安全体系,以确保关键信息资产的安全可靠。